I have an 11 month old son. With the rear facing seat in the center, we are good. With twins you won't have that option. I'm 6'5" and there is no way I could drive the truck with a rear facing seat directly behind me. You need to figure out the seats you are going to use and go to the dealer, install it, and see if it works. This is exactly what I did. Once they hit 1 year and 25lbs(atleast in Kentucky), you can flip the seats around which is a whole different ballgame. There would be no problem with room at that point.

Rear facing seats suck.
